What Happened

Cylake has just unveiled a groundbreaking security platform that promises to change the way organizations handle their data. Instead of relying on cloud services, which can raise concerns about data sovereignty?, Cylake's solution analyzes security data locally?. This means that sensitive information remains within the organization's infrastructure, reducing the risk of exposure to external threats.

The launch comes at a time when many companies are increasingly worried about data privacy and security. With cyberattacks on the rise, the need for robust security measures has never been more urgent. By offering a solution that operates independently of the cloud, Cylake aims to provide peace of mind for organizations that prioritize data sovereignty? and want to maintain control over their security processes.
